Electric vehicle charging stations play an important role in supporting the adoption of EVs by addressing "range anxiety". There are different levels of charging with Level 1 being the slowest using a standard 120V outlet, and Level 3/DC fast charging being the fastest but requiring more specialized and expensive equipment. Wireless and solar charging techniques are also being explored. Norway is testing wireless induction charging roads for electric taxis. As EV adoption increases, expanding public charging infrastructure and using solar and vehicle-to-vehicle charging can help increase access to renewable energy for electric transport.
